PLU 4132


Gala Apple

"A sweet and crunchy apple variety loved by many."

Sweet and crunchy with hints of vanilla, the Gala apple is a popular variety known for its vibrant yellow and red striped skin.

Also known as

Royal Gala, Kids' Gala

Botanical name

Malus domestica

About Gala Apple

Originating from New Zealand, the Gala apple is a cross between the Kidd's Orange Red and Golden Delicious varieties.

Nutrition Information

One medium-sized Gala apple, approximately 150 grams, contains:

Energy 51 kcal

Carbohydrates 13.6 grams

Fiber 2.4 grams

Sugar 9.5 grams

Protein 0.3 grams

Fat 0.2 grams

Sodium 0 milligrams

Potassium 154 milligrams

Folate 3 micrograms

Vitamin C 4.6 milligrams

Vitamin A 54 IU

Storage & Handling

Refrigerated storage with controlled atmosphere to maintain optimal temperature and humidity

Temperature

0°C to 4°C (32°F to 39°F)

Humidity

80-90%

Packaging

Ventilated boxes or containers to prevent moisture accumulation

Shelf Life

4-6 months

Storage Notes: Quick cooling after harvesting and regular inspection to prevent spoilage

PLU Reference

4-digit codes: Conventional produce

5-digit (9xxx): Organic produce

5-digit (8xxx): GMO (rarely used)
